Finely carved from hardwood and crowned with expressive anthropomorphic figures, these ornaments exemplify the intimate relationship between ancestral imagery, status display, and ceremonial identity.<\/p>\n<p class=\"\" data-start=\"711\" data-end=\"1233\">Each hair pin is uniquely rendered, featuring a miniature seated human figure delicately sculpted at the apex. The elongated bodies, stylized facial features, and carefully balanced proportions reflect a highly developed carving tradition in which the human form serves as both decorative motif and spiritual representation. Such figures are often associated with ancestral guardians, clan lineage, fertility symbolism, or protective spirits believed to accompany the wearer during important communal and ritual occasions.<\/p>\n<p data-start=\"1235\" data-end=\"1642\">The warm honey-brown patina, developed through age and handling, enhances the visual depth of the carvings while highlighting subtle differences in artistic execution. Particularly notable is the central example, distinguished by its lighter tone and finely incised spiral ornamentation, a motif frequently associated with continuity, life force, and cyclical renewal across many Austronesian cultures.<\/p>\n<p data-start=\"1644\" data-end=\"2115\">Hair ornaments of this type were more than simple accessories. Within traditional societies of the Lesser Sundas, elaborately carved hair pins formed an integral part of ceremonial attire worn during marriages, festivals, rites of passage, and other occasions where social status and cultural identity were publicly expressed. Their elegant proportions allowed them to function both as practical adornments and as visible markers of craftsmanship, heritage, and prestige.<\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n","protected":false},"featured_media":13313,"comment_status":"open","ping_status":"closed","template":"","meta":{"site-sidebar-layout":"default","site-content-layout":"","ast-site-content-layout":"default","site-content-style":"default","site-sidebar-style":"default","ast-global-header-display":"","ast-banner-title-visibility":"","ast-main-header-display":"","ast-hfb-above-header-display":"","ast-hfb-below-header-display":"","ast-hfb-mobile-header-display":"","site-post-title":"","ast-breadcrumbs-content":"","ast-featured-img":"","footer-sml-layout":"","ast-disable-related-posts":"","theme-transparent-header-meta":"default","adv-header-id-meta":"","stick-header-meta":"","header-above-stick-meta":"","header-main-stick-meta":"","header-below-stick-meta":"","astra-migrate-meta-layouts":"set","ast-page-background-enabled":"default","ast-page-background-meta":{"desktop":{"background-color":"","background-image":"","background-repeat":"repeat","background-position":"center
